Autor Thema: Anzahl der Dokumente im Dircat  (Gelesen 1675 mal)

Offline Hive

  • Senior Mitglied
  • ****
  • Beiträge: 345
  • Geschlecht: Männlich
  • Whooaaaa!!
    • g-notes.de
Anzahl der Dokumente im Dircat
« am: 20.02.07 - 17:38:05 »
Ist mir glatt peinlich die Frage zu stellen .. aber mir ist gerade beim Debuggen aufgefallen das bei 4000 Usern/Einträgen die Eigeschaften des Dircat nur 25 Dokumente anzeigt .. paßt doch gar nicht ?? Oder hab ich jetzt einen Denkfehler ..

KAI
I love deadlines, i love the whooshing sound they make when they pass by

Offline Steve_O.

  • Gold Platin u.s.w. member:)
  • *****
  • Beiträge: 857
  • Geschlecht: Männlich
Re: Anzahl der Dokumente im Dircat
« Antwort #1 am: 21.02.07 - 08:33:23 »
Ohne jetzt wirklich Hintergründe nennen zu können,
kann ich dich aber beruhigen.
Im dircat passt diese Zahl mit den dargestellten Einträgen nie, da irgend etwas
komprimiert wird... ich höre lieber auf, bevor man mich auslacht...

Fazit: Es passt, dass es nicht passt!!  ;D
"Wir können Probleme nicht mit dem Denken lösen,
das zu ihnen geführt hat." ( A. Einstein )
________

Offline eknori

  • @Notes Preisträger
  • Moderator
  • Gold Platin u.s.w. member:)
  • *****
  • Beiträge: 11.728
  • Geschlecht: Männlich
Re: Anzahl der Dokumente im Dircat
« Antwort #2 am: 21.02.07 - 08:36:17 »
Zitat
Oder hab ich jetzt einen Denkfehler
Du hast ...

When the Dircat task combines multiple documents from source Domino directories into single documents ...
Egal wie tief man die Messlatte für den menschlichen Verstand auch ansetzt: jeden Tag kommt jemand und marschiert erhobenen Hauptes drunter her!

Offline Hive

  • Senior Mitglied
  • ****
  • Beiträge: 345
  • Geschlecht: Männlich
  • Whooaaaa!!
    • g-notes.de
Re: Anzahl der Dokumente im Dircat
« Antwort #3 am: 21.02.07 - 09:18:44 »
Ich muss ja dazu sagen, dass ich mich mit Lotus schon seit 8 oder 9 Jahren beschäftige aber das ist mir noch nie aufgefallen. 1ch wollte gestern eine domainübergreifende Prüfung von Benutzernamen programmieren und es kam kein vernüftiges Ergebniss bei rum.

Es gibt im Dircat die Person und die People Maske. Zweite sieht so aus als würde sie gemäß Ulrich mehrere Dokumente in einem kombinieren. Aber es gibt auch eine Ansicht nach der ersten (Person) Maske(select form="person") und die enthält 4000 Einträge. Dann sollte es doch auch 4000 Dokumente geben. Dazu kommt ebenfalls dass wenn ich im designer diese Ansicht öffne es zu dem Fehler kommt "Eintrag nicht vorhanden", im Client wird sie jedoch angezeigt.

Aber danke für die Antworten. Ich werd mir mal einen alternativen Weg ausdenken.

MfG KAI
« Letzte Änderung: 21.02.07 - 09:20:37 von Hive »
I love deadlines, i love the whooshing sound they make when they pass by

Offline eknori

  • @Notes Preisträger
  • Moderator
  • Gold Platin u.s.w. member:)
  • *****
  • Beiträge: 11.728
  • Geschlecht: Männlich
Re: Anzahl der Dokumente im Dircat
« Antwort #4 am: 21.02.07 - 09:21:17 »
Zitat
und die enthält 4000 Einträge.

Dan markiere mal einen Eintrag in der Ansicht. Da werden dann mehrere Einträge markiert ...
Egal wie tief man die Messlatte für den menschlichen Verstand auch ansetzt: jeden Tag kommt jemand und marschiert erhobenen Hauptes drunter her!

Offline Hive

  • Senior Mitglied
  • ****
  • Beiträge: 345
  • Geschlecht: Männlich
  • Whooaaaa!!
    • g-notes.de
Re: Anzahl der Dokumente im Dircat
« Antwort #5 am: 21.02.07 - 09:42:54 »
Das ist ja der Witz, es handelt sich zumindest dem Verhalten des Clients nach zu urteilen um 4000 Einträge. Markiert man einen Eintrag wird auch nur ein Eintrag markiert.

Ich hab die Spalte der Ansicht gerüft ob es dazu kommen kann das ein dokument mehrfach gelistet wird und es geht nicht. Die Ansicht besteht aus zwei Zeilen

Spalte 1:
@If(Type = "Group"; 4; Type = "Person"; 3;Type="Database"; 2; Type="Server";53;0 )

Spalte 2
Code
DisplayPersonName := @If(
   Type = "Person"; @Implode(@Trim(@Subset(LastName; 1) : @Subset(FirstName; 1)); " , ")+ " " + MiddleInitial; "");

DisplayName := @If(
   Type = "Group"; @Subset(ListName; 1);
   Type="Server"; Servername; 
   @If(DisplayPersonName = ""; @Subset(FullName; 1); 
   DisplayPersonName));

@Name([Abbreviate]; DisplayName)

Tja es müßten 4000 Dokumente sein, nur leider scheint es die nicht wirklich zu geben
« Letzte Änderung: 21.02.07 - 10:17:26 von Hive »
I love deadlines, i love the whooshing sound they make when they pass by

Offline hallo.dirk

  • Gold Platin u.s.w. member:)
  • *****
  • Beiträge: 2.166
  • Geschlecht: Männlich
  • Admin forever ;)
Re: Anzahl der Dokumente im Dircat
« Antwort #6 am: 21.02.07 - 11:24:54 »
Zitat
--------------------------------------------------------------------------------
Condensed Directory Catalogs
You create a condensed Directory Catalog from the Directory Catalog template (DIRCAT5.NTF). Condensed Directory Catalogs are designed to be small enough to fit on Notes clients. For example, several Domino directories that together contain more than 350,000 users and total 3GB in size, when aggregated in a condensed Directory Catalog are likely to be only about 50MB. In general, each user and group entry is slightly more than 100 bytes. Condensed directory catalog are designed primarily for use on Notes clients.
To achieve its small size, a condensed Directory Catalog uses a unique design that combines multiple documents from the Domino Directories into single documents in the directory catalog, and that limits the number of sorted views available for lookups.

Aggregate documents

One reason a condensed Directory Catalog is small is it combines many entries from the source Domino Directories into single aggregate documents. A single Directory Catalog aggregate document can contain up to 250 source directory entries, although on average the maximum is about 200. This means that a condensed Directory Catalog needs to use only about 1000 aggregate documents to store information from 200,000 documents in the source Domino Directories.

Limited number of views

A condensed Directory Catalog is also small because it contains only a few, small views. By contrast a Domino Directory and an Extended Directory Catalog have multiple, typically large views.


$Users view This is the one view used in a condensed Directory Catalog for name lookups. When you configure the directory catalog you choose how to sort this view, either by distinguished name, by last name, or by alternate name. To find names that don't correspond to the selected sort order, a full-text search is done of the directory catalog rather than a view lookup.
You shouldn't open the aggregate documents in the $Users view manually; these documents are not intended for viewing, and it can take a considerable amount of time to format them for that purpose.

$Unid view This view contains information needed by the Dircat task to replicate the source directory entries into the directory catalog. The $Unid view isn't created on replicas of the directory catalog, which further reduces the directory catalog size.

$PeopleGroupsFlat view This view displays directory names when Notes users click the Address button to browse directories.

Configuration view This view shows the Configuration document that contains the directory catalog configuration settings.

Users view This is a view that users can open and programs can access to see the names included in the directory catalog. This view is not stored on disk but is instead built as needed.


Design changes
In general, you should not change the database design of a condensed Directory Catalog. One exception is changing the name of the Users view; you can change the name of this view, as long as you keep the original view name, Users, as an alias.


Na, bei dem Teil der Admin Schulung geschlafen? ;) ;D
Gruss
Dirk

------------------------------------------------------------
Sametime
Traveler
IQ Suite von Group Technologies
Marvel Client von Panagenda
Blackberry Enterprise
FIRM von HASDL 
BELOS von Bechtle
mobile.profiler (MDM) und traveler.rules von Midpoints

Offline Hive

  • Senior Mitglied
  • ****
  • Beiträge: 345
  • Geschlecht: Männlich
  • Whooaaaa!!
    • g-notes.de
Re: Anzahl der Dokumente im Dircat
« Antwort #7 am: 21.02.07 - 13:16:55 »
Danke .. jau den Dircat hab ich immer etwas stiefmütterlich betrachtet .. bin auch noch nie auf die Idee gekommen, den für ein Namelookup zu benutzen ..

Ich werds auch versprochen!! nnieeeeee wieeeedddeeeer versuuuuuuchen

 :knuddel: KAI
I love deadlines, i love the whooshing sound they make when they pass by

 

Impressum Atnotes.de  -  Powered by Syslords Solutions  -  Datenschutz